OK, I now see this post, as opposed to your Cape Cod one. Newport definitely fits the bill on everything you are looking for except for Whale Watching.

The Inn at Newport Beach is actually across the beach in Middletown, and a short drive or trolley ride to downtown Newport. Rocky Coastline if you take the 10 mile drive, you can take a tour of Rose Island lighthouse if it's available. But you can look at Castle Hill Light, or Goat Island Light on your own.

Didn't know that you were open to other options other than the Cape. For a short 2 day trip with everything centrally located, I would definitely pick Newport.
